Overview
To manage the day-to-day IT operations of the property, ensuring all systems, networks, equipment, and technology services are functioning effectively to support business operations and user requirements.

THE JOBSCOPE
  • Oversee daily IT operations and services within the property.
  • Provide technical support to all departments and users.
  • Troubleshoot hardware, software, network, system, and connectivity issues.
  • Maintain computers, servers, network equipment, printers, POS systems, and other IT devices.
  • Monitor network and system performance and ensure issues are resolved promptly.
  • Manage user accounts, email accounts, system access, and permissions.
  • Install, configure, and maintain IT hardware and software.
  • Ensure regular system updates, backups, and maintenance are carried out.
  • Monitor IT security, antivirus protection, and access controls.
  • Maintain IT equipment, asset records, software licences, and warranties.
  • Coordinate with external IT vendors and service providers for maintenance and technical support.
  • Support the IT requirements of meetings, events, and daily property operations.
  • Assist with IT projects, system upgrades, installations, and improvements.
  • Identify technology requirements and recommend practical solutions.
  • Maintain records of IT incidents, maintenance, equipment, and system configurations.
  • Monitor IT-related expenses and assist with procurement when required.
  • Ensure compliance with company IT policies, procedures, and security standards.
  • Provide timely support for urgent IT issues to minimise disruption to operations.
  • Work closely with department heads to understand and address their IT requirements.
  • Perform other duties assigned by management.
REQUIREMENTS
  • Minimum 3–5 years of relevant IT experience.
  • Experience in IT support, networking, infrastructure, and troubleshooting.
  • Good knowledge of hardware, software, Microsoft 365, and network systems.
  • Good problem-solving and communication skills.
  • Service-oriented and responsive to users’ needs.
  • Well-organised and able to manage multiple priorities.
  • Able to coordinate with external vendors and service providers.
  • Willing to work shifts or provide support outside normal working hours when required.
